Lady MLAs strengthen Jharkhand’s voice: CM Soren on Women’s Day
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

THE JHARKHAND STORY NETWORK

 

Ranchi, March 7: 11 women MLAs of the Jharkhand Assembly met Chief Minister Hemant Soren today in his chamber. On the occasion of International Women’s Day, the Chief Minister extended his heartfelt greetings and best wishes to all women ministers and MLAs.

He emphasized that their presence in the Jharkhand Legislative Assembly strengthens women’s power. Regardless of political affiliation—whether in the ruling party or the opposition—each of them represents the voice of women’s safety, self-reliance, and empowerment in the House.

Women’s Participation is Key to Holistic Development

The Chief Minister highlighted that the active participation of half the population is essential for the holistic development of the country, state, and society. He reaffirmed the government’s commitment to women’s empowerment and welfare through various initiatives, including the Jharkhand Mukhyamantri Maiya Samman Yojana.

Women Bringing Pride to the State

Expressing his pride, the Chief Minister acknowledged the remarkable achievements of Jharkhand’s women in various fields—economic, social, political, educational, cultural, and sports. He commended their hard work and talent, which have brought laurels to the state.

“Today, women are making significant strides in every field. The government is fully committed to supporting them in achieving their goals,” he said.

Concluding his address, he once again extended his congratulations on International Women’s Day.

Attendees

The event was attended by ministers Deepika Pandey and Shilpi Neha Tirkey, along with MLAs Kalpana Soren, Neera Yadav, Louis Marandi, Savita Mahto, Ragini Singh, Mamta Devi, Purnima Das Sahu, Shweta Singh, and Manju Kumari.
